The net debt of Borosil Renewables is decreasing.
Latest net debt of Borosil Renewables is ₹113 Crs as of Mar-25.
This is less than Mar-24 when it was ₹240 Crs.
No, profit is decreasing.
The profit of Borosil Renewables is -₹276.36 Crs for TTM, -₹69.57 Crs for Mar 2025 and -₹46.9 Crs for Mar 2024.
